Reading Notes on Dasgupta, "Economics: A Very Short Introduction": Households and Firms

Discussion Questions:





Where have all the women gone?

Why do we think that Africa's population is likely to grow much faster than India's population over the next fifty years?

How does Desta's household react to the fact that GEICO does not sell insurance policies in their neighborhood?

How does Becky's family react to the fact that they can borrow from Umpqua Bank and invest in the Vanguard Funds--rather than having to deal with the local moneylender?

Why does Becky's world have large-scale firms?

Why does Becky's world have joint-stock limited-liability companies?

Why does Becky's world have tradable financial assets?
